Dachshund
Short legs, big spirit, and a nose always on duty. Many owners notice a Dachshund pads behind them from room to room, curious and loyal.
Yet a well-stocked toy basket can keep that clever hunter busy while you answer emails.
Try scent games using hidden treats under cups. Ten minutes of sniff work tires the mind nicely.
A snug blanket burrow adds comfort, so they can supervise you from a warm, self-made tunnel without constant fuss.
Miniature Schnauzer
Bushy eyebrows give away every thought, from curious to determined. A Miniature Schnauzer often heels close like a tiny supervisor, yet thrives with tasks.
Offer short training bursts mixed with independent play using a snuffle mat or a kibble-dispensing ball.
Because they enjoy purpose, rotate simple jobs like fetching the mail or carrying a soft toy. Mental work counts as exercise.
Afterward, that wiry buddy naps contentedly while you finish chores without constant entertainment.
Pug
Comedy face, old-soul heart. Pugs adore being close, often settling at your feet like a warm slipper.
Still, a simple lick mat spread with yogurt or pumpkin can keep them relaxed and content while you cook or study.
Short, gentle walks suit their build. Then swap in a soft puzzle toy to prevent boredom.
Keep rooms cool and breaks frequent. You get cuddly company, and they enjoy calm, self-guided fun between snuggle sessions.

Italian Greyhound
As graceful as a sketch, the Italian Greyhound glides after you quietly. When you pause, they melt into a sunspot and sigh.
A few zoomies satisfy their bursty energy, then a soft sweater or heated pad becomes a personal lounge.
Engage the mind with gentle fetch down a hallway. Keep sessions short to protect those slender legs.
After a quick cuddle check-in, they return to cozy, independent loaf mode while you carry on.

French Bulldog
With a grin that melts stress, the French Bulldog shadows your steps like a friendly statue coming to life. Energy comes in funny spurts, then fades to snorts and naps.
A tough chew or food puzzle keeps them engaged while you work.
Choose short, cool walks to protect breathing. Then offer quiet enrichment instead of rough play.
The result is a loyal sidekick who entertains themselves between your check-ins, staying content and close.
